Nephrotoxicity is a significant concern during the development of new drugs or when assessing the safety of chemicals in consumer products. Traditional methods for testing nephrotoxicity involve animal models or 2D in vitro cell cultures, the latter of which lack the complexity and functionality of the human kidney. 3D in vitro models are created by culturing human primary kidney cells derived from urine in a 3D microenvironment that mimics the fluid shear stresses of the kidney. Thus, 3D in vitro models provide more accurate and reliable predictions of human nephrotoxicity compared to existing 2D models. In this review, we focus on precision nephrotoxicity testing using 3D in vitro models with human autologous urine-derived kidney cells as a promising approach for evaluating drug safety.

Research surrounding tumor boards has focused on patient outcomes and care coordination. Little is known about the patient experience with tumor boards. This survey examined aspects of the patient experience for patients presented at our multidisciplinary endocrine tumor board (ETB). A 15-item survey was distributed via the online patient portal to patients over the age of 18 whose case had been discussed at our ETB over an 18-month period. Descriptive statistics were reported, and a Fisher's exact test was used to examine relationships between variables. A total of 47 patients completed the survey (46%). A majority (72%) report their provider explained what the ETB is, and 77% report being informed their case would be discussed. Most patients were satisfied their case was being discussed (72%). A number of patients did report moderate or severe anxiety knowing their case was being discussed (15%). Sixty-four percent of patients report the ETB recommendations were clearly explained; however, satisfaction with the recommendations was slightly lower (53%). Despite the somewhat low satisfaction with the recommendations, 75% of patients felt more confident in their treatment plan knowing their case was discussed. Finally, if given the chance, 66% responded that they would have been interested in participating in their own ETB discussion. This study provides some insight into the patient experience surrounding tumor board discussions. Overall, patients are satisfied when their case is discussed at ETB. Patients can also experience anxiety about these discussions, and many patients desire to be present for their own discussions.

Literature suggests patients with thyroid cancer have unmet informational needs in many aspects of care. Patients often turn to online resources for their health-related information, and generative artificial intelligence programs such as ChatGPT are an emerging and attractive resource for patients.
To assess the quality of ChatGPT's responses to thyroid cancer-related questions.
Four endocrinologists and 4 endocrine surgeons, all with expertise in thyroid cancer, evaluated the responses to 20 thyroid cancer-related questions. Responses were scored on a 7-point Likert scale in areas of accuracy, completeness, and overall satisfaction. Comments from the evaluators were aggregated and a qualitative analysis was performed.
Overall, only 57%, 56%, and 52% of the responses \"agreed\" or \"strongly agreed\" that ChatGPT's answers were accurate, complete, and satisfactory, respectively. One hundred ninety-eight free-text comments were included in the qualitative analysis. The majority of comments were critical in nature. Several themes emerged, which included overemphasis of diet and iodine intake and its role in thyroid cancer, and incomplete or inaccurate information on risks of both thyroid surgery and radioactive iodine therapy.
Our study suggests that ChatGPT is not accurate or reliable enough at this time for unsupervised use as a patient information tool for thyroid cancer.

Multiple endocrine neoplasia 2A presenting in a family with a history of Hirschprung’s disease
2021
ABSTRACT
Hirschprung’s disease co-occurs with multiple endocrine neoplasia type 2A infrequently but at a higher rate with certain RET mutations. We present a case of a patient evaluated for an adrenal incidentaloma with a history of familial Hirschprung’s. Our patient was found to have synchronous pheochromocytoma and medullary thyroid carcinoma illustrating the importance of genetic testing in these patients to determine appropriate screening for endocrine tumors.

Severe Hyperprolactinemia in a Patient With Concurrent ESRD and Medication Use
2021
Background: A mild increase in prolactin has been previously reported in patients with pathological conditions, such as ESRD, as well as with several medications. Typically this is a mild elevation (<100 ng/mL), though certain medications have been shown to increase prolactin up to 200 ng/mL. However, we report a case of severe hyperprolactinemia in a patient with ESRD and on medications known to cause mild prolactin elevations. Clinical Case: Our patient is a 35-year-old female presenting for hyperprolactinemia. She has a history of uncontrolled diabetes with complications of ESRD on iHD, gastroparesis, and neuropathy. Further history revealed galactorrhea for 15 years following the birth of her second child as well as amenorrhea for the last 1.5 years. At the time of evaluation, she was not breastfeeding and did not have any reported life stressors. Medications were unchanged and included metoclopramide 10 mg daily and promethazine 25 mg PRN. Initial prolactin level one year prior to visit was 618 ng/mL. TSH 1.33. Brain MRI at that time did not reveal a pituitary mass, though pituitary protocol was not performed. Prolactin repeated on our initial visit had increased to 1352 ng/mL. Pituitary MRI was without evidence of pituitary mass. Despite discussing the importance of estrogen replacement, the patient was not interested in OCP therapy due to prior intolerance. Clinical Lesson(s): Hyperprolactinemia can be seen in patients on hemodialysis as a result of increased secretion in the uremic state and decreased clearance. Dialysis does not significantly improve the prolactin level. A recent study revealed a median prolactin of 65.2 ng/mL in dialysis patients. Our case emphasizes that the degree of hyperprolactinemia as a result of ESRD and medications can vary widely. It remains important to continue to consider the diagnosis of pituitary pathology in patients with a prolactin level that is higher than expected. However, if imaging is unrevealing, as in our patient, hyperprolactinemia may be attributed to medications and pathological disease states. Elevated serum prolactin has been shown to increase cardiovascular and all-cause mortality in a level-dependent effect. Hyperprolactinemia has also been associated with insulin resistance and worsened diabetes control. As we continue to learn more regarding the negative side effects of prolactin, it may become increasingly important to monitor and reduce prolactin levels in our patients, especially those on dialysis already with an elevated risk of cardiovascular disease.

West Nile virus (WNV) is a globally distributed mosquito-borne virus of great public health concern. The number of WNV human cases and mosquito infection patterns vary in space and time. Many statistical models have been developed to understand and predict WNV geographic and temporal dynamics. However, these modeling efforts have been disjointed with little model comparison and inconsistent validation. In this paper, we describe a framework to unify and standardize WNV modeling efforts nationwide. WNV risk, detection, or warning models for this review were solicited from active research groups working in different regions of the United States. A total of 13 models were selected and described. The spatial and temporal scales of each model were compared to guide the timing and the locations for mosquito and virus surveillance, to support mosquito vector control decisions, and to assist in conducting public health outreach campaigns at multiple scales of decision-making. Our overarching goal is to bridge the existing gap between model development, which is usually conducted as an academic exercise, and practical model applications, which occur at state, tribal, local, or territorial public health and mosquito control agency levels. The proposed model assessment and comparison framework helps clarify the value of individual models for decision-making and identifies the appropriate temporal and spatial scope of each model. This qualitative evaluation clearly identifies gaps in linking models to applied decisions and sets the stage for a quantitative comparison of models. Specifically, whereas many coarse-grained models (county resolution or greater) have been developed, the greatest need is for fine-grained, short-term planning models (m–km, days–weeks) that remain scarce. We further recommend quantifying the value of information for each decision to identify decisions that would benefit most from model input.
